Responsibilities:

Responsible for the operation and maintenance of landfill gas collection and control systems (GCCS) that supports a High BTU landfill gas plant. Includes the supervision and direction of technicians and contractors.

Properly operate and maintain GCCS in a timely and cost-effective manner to ensure regulatory compliance and optimize performance.

Calibrate, operate and maintain sensitive electronic data collection devices necessary to optimize LFG collection from the wellfield.

Collect and manage data entry from environmental monitoring locations

Implement and manage the GCCS preventative maintenance plan

Operate and maintain liquid management system pneumatic or electric driven pumps (troubleshoot and determine liquid heights within liquid containment structures and or LFG collection wells)

Perform wellfield valve/vacuum adjustments, data collection and maintenance; interpret data

Use Polyvinyl Chloride (PVC) or High Density Polyethylene (HDPE) piping materials and associated equipment to perform maintenance on piping materials

Troubleshoot GCCS and related systems

Supervise gas technicians; delegate work assignments 40%

Train gas technicians on GCCS operations and maintenance activities; mentor and evaluate technician proficiency

Provide project management support to management for GCCS design and construction

Ability to prepare reports at the state or local levels.

Participate in the development of LFG related capital and expense budgets

Review and analyze GCCS operating data and prepare reports

Be available for on-call response (physically on site or by phone as required) to GCCS related malfunction events
